newsence
來源篩選

Using an engineering notebook

Hacker News

This article discusses the importance and best practices of using an engineering notebook for technical professionals. It covers how to effectively document projects, ideas, and experiments to aid in future reference and collaboration.

newsence

使用工程師筆記本

Hacker News
19 天前

AI 生成摘要

這篇文章討論了工程師筆記本對技術專業人士的重要性及最佳實踐。它涵蓋了如何有效地記錄專案、想法和實驗,以便將來參考和協作。

背景

在數位工具普及的當代,軟體工程師 Nicole 提出了一個看似復古的觀點:使用實體筆記本進行「工程筆記」是提升生產力最關鍵的實踐。這篇文章引發了 Hacker News 社群對於手寫筆記、思考流程以及記憶機制的大量討論,探討在程式碼與數位文件之外,工程師該如何有效地記錄與梳理思維。

社群觀點

社群對於工程筆記的價值達成了高度共識,但對於「形式」與「目的」則有截然不同的實踐方式。許多支持者強調,手寫筆記的核心價值不在於產出的「文件」,而在於「書寫的過程」。這種觀點認為,手寫能強迫大腦放慢速度,將抽象的想法具象化,進而強化記憶。有留言者指出,手寫筆記就像是為大腦開啟了「高層級日誌模式」,在處理複雜的除錯任務或演算法設計時,透過紙筆勾勒結構、繪製圖表或列出假設,能有效避免在數位工具中因頻繁切換視窗而產生的認知負荷。

然而,對於筆記是否應該「永久保存」則存在爭論。部分資深工程師遵循傳統實驗室筆記的規範,要求頁碼連續且不可撕毀,將其視為法律或專利上的重要憑證。但更多現代開發者傾向將紙本視為「唯寫媒體」或「拋棄式草稿」,認為筆記的階段性任務在於理清當下的邏輯,一旦問題解決,這些筆記便失去了參考價值。為了平衡這兩種需求,有人提出了「兩本筆記策略」:一本用於隨手塗鴉與快速紀錄的口袋本,另一本則用於整理後的永久存檔,這種做法能減少因害怕「弄亂筆記本」而產生的心理壓力。

反對完全依賴實體筆記的觀點則聚焦於數位工具的不可替代性。部分留言者認為,手寫的速度跟不上思維,且缺乏搜尋、備份與版本控制功能。對於習慣快速迭代的開發者來說,在 Obsidian 或純文字檔案中記錄,並配合自訂的連結與腳本,能更有效地整合程式碼片段與外部參考資料。此外,也有人提到,隨著美國專利制度轉向「先申請制」,實體筆記在法律上的證據地位已不如以往,這使得筆記的實踐更偏向個人化的思考輔助,而非強制性的合規要求。

有趣的是,社群中也出現了折衷方案的討論,例如使用電子墨水設備。這類裝置既保留了手寫的觸感與專注感,又具備數位化的管理優勢。無論工具為何,社群普遍認同「寫下來」是工程實踐中不可或缺的一環,它能幫助開發者在每日的站立會議中快速回溯進度,並在年度績效考核時提供具體的貢獻佐證。

延伸閱讀

在討論中,社群成員分享了多項有助於提升思考與紀錄品質的資源。在硬體方面,Supernote Nomad 與 Rhodia Webnotebook 是被多次提及的筆記工具。在方法論上,Morgan Jones 的著作《The Thinker's Toolkit》提供了十四種結構化的問題解決技術,被認為是工程筆記內容的極佳指引。此外,Edsger Dijkstra 的手稿與 Kent Beck 關於決策紀錄的建議,也被視為工程師學習書寫實踐的典範。針對數位與實體轉換,有人推薦使用 Obsidian 結合自訂的 URL scheme(如 vim://)來串接筆記與本地程式碼。